Job Description, Detailed

Job Title: Supervisor, Physician Office-non RN

Expected Pay:
Range: $33.52 – $47.22 per hour
Type: Salaried position
Determination Factors: Actual pay will be based on experience, skills, and internal equity.

Position Summary (Overview & Responsibilities):
The Supervisor, Physician Office-non RN is a leadership role responsible for the day-to-day operations of a medical office practice. Key responsibilities include:
Supervision & Direction: Supervising, directing, and scheduling team members within clinic locations.
Patient Needs: Collaborating with team members to effectively meet patient needs.
Performance Evaluation: Working with office leadership to evaluate the overall performance of team members, ensuring the delivery of high-quality patient care.
Business Operations: Effectively addressing business operation needs.
Financial & Policy Adherence: Partnering with office leadership on recommending budgets and ensuring adherence to established policies and procedures.
Relationship Management: Maintaining cooperative working relationships with various internal and external stakeholders, including physicians, advanced practice providers, OSFMG Coordinators, Medical Center personnel, other OSF entities, and external agencies and organizations.
Leadership & Advocacy: Leading by example, conducting oneself in a positive and professional manner, and acting as an advocate for the team members within the practice.
